What is Algebra
Algebra is a branch of mathematics that deals with the study of mathematical symbols and the rules for manipulating these symbols. It involves using variables to represent numbers or quantities, and manipulating these variables using mathematical operations such as addition, subtraction, multiplication, and division.

Algebra is used to solve problems in many areas, including science, engineering, finance, and economics. It is also an important tool in the study of other branches of mathematics, such as geometry, calculus, and number theory.

The study of algebra involves learning about various topics such as equations, inequalities, functions, graphs, matrices, and polynomials. The fundamental theorem of Algebra--The fundamental theorem of algebra, which states that every non-constant polynomial equation with complex coefficients has at least one complex root, was first proved by the mathematician Carl Friedrich Gauss in 1799. However, various aspects of the theorem were studied by mathematicians such as Isaac Newton, René Descartes, and Leonhard Euler in the centuries before Gauss's work.

There are different types of algebra, including:

👉Elementary algebra: This is the branch of algebra that deals with the basic concepts of algebra, such as solving linear equations, simplifying expressions, and manipulating polynomials.

👉Abstract algebra: This is the study of algebraic structures such as groups, rings, and fields. It involves the study of abstract mathematical objects and their properties.

👉Linear algebra: This is the branch of algebra that deals with linear equations, matrices, and vectors. It has many applications in engineering, physics, and computer science.

👉Boolean algebra: This is a branch of algebra that deals with logical expressions and truth values. It has applications in digital logic design and computer science.

👉Number theory: This is a branch of algebra that deals with the properties of numbers and their relationships. It has applications in cryptography and computer science.

👉Algebraic geometry: This is the study of geometric objects that are defined by algebraic equations. It has applications in physics and engineering.
Algebraic Q&A Example--

Sure, here are a few algebraic questions and their solutions:

👉Solve for x: 2x + 5 = 13
Solution:
Subtract 5 from both sides of the equation:
2x = 8
Divide both sides by 2:
x = 4

👉Simplify the expression: 3x^2 + 2x^2 - x^2
Solution:
Combining like terms, we get:
3x^2 + 2x^2 - x^2 = 4x^2

👉Factorize the expression: 4x^2 - 25
Solution:
This is a difference of squares, so we can factorize it as:
4x^2 - 25 = (2x + 5)(2x - 5)

👉Solve for x: 2(3x - 1) = 8x + 6
Solution:
Distribute the 2 on the left side of the equation:
6x - 2 = 8x + 6
Subtract 6x from both sides of the equation:
-2 = 2x + 6
Subtract 6 from both sides of the equation:
-8 = 2x
Divide both sides by 2:
x = -4

👉Simplify the expression: (3x + 2y)^2
Solution:
Using the formula (a + b)^2 = a^2 + 2ab + b^2, we get:
(3x + 2y)^2 = (3x)^2 + 2(3x)(2y) + (2y)^2

Algebra solving trick--
One algebra solving trick that can be helpful is to isolate the variable by performing the same operation on both sides of the equation. For example, if you have the equation:

2x + 5 = 11

You can isolate the variable x by subtracting 5 from both sides of the equation:

2x + 5 - 5 = 11 - 5

Simplifying, you get:

2x = 6

Then, to isolate x, you can divide both sides by 2:

2x/2 = 6/2

Simplifying further, you get:

x = 3

This algebra solving trick is called the "balance method" and it involves keeping the equation balanced by performing the same operation on both sides of the equation. It's a useful trick to keep in mind when solving algebraic equations.
